How long do you slow cook turkey wings?
Cover the crock pot and cook for 3 to 4 hours on high, or until turkey wings are done. The safe minimum temperature for turkey is 165 F. Serve and enjoy.

Are turkey wings healthy?
Turkey wings are dark meat, which makes them higher in fat and calories than white-meat turkey. However, turkey wings are a source of protein and other nutrients, such as selenium, iron and calcium. A roasted turkey wing makes for a protein-packed main course.
How do you deep fry turkey wings?
Heat oil in a deep-fryer or large saucepan to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Cook the turkey wings in the hot oil for 15 minutes, then turn the wings over, and continue cooking until the meat is no longer pink at the bone, 10 to 15 minutes.

How long do you boil turkey wings before frying them?
Add water, butter and salt to the pot. Turn the stove on to medium-high. Let the turkey wings cook for about 45 minutes. If you can stick a fork in the turkey wings, then you are ready to begin frying.
